Citi has been in Singapore since 1902 and is represented in nearly every asset class. Citi Singapore is the largest foreign banking employer in Singapore, and it is home to strategically important hubs, Innovation Labs and the Asia Pacific Citi Service Centre (CSC).
We have businesses with client-focused capabilities, such as the Global Subsidiaries Group (Asia), Citi Private Bank (Global), and International Personal Bank (Global); product-focused innovation hubs, such as Global Consumer Bank, the ASEAN Investment Banking Hub, Markets Hub, and the Treasury and Trade Services (TTS) Hub; Innovation Labs, such as the Citi Innovation Lab (TTS) and the Consumer Innovation Lab; and the Asia Pacific Citi Service Centre (CSC) at Changi Business Park.
Citibank Singapore is built around three key business lines: (1) wealth management products and services, including investments, insurance, deposits and treasury products; (2) unsecured products such as credit cards and personal line of credit, and (3) secured products covering housing loans and share financing.

Founded in 2013, Tongdun Technology is a professional independent Intelligent Risk Management service provider headquartered in Hangzhou, Zhejiang. Since its inception, Tongdun has been serving its clients under a risk control concept that lies on building an “intelligent trusted network”. By integrating artificial intelligence into risk control, it offers clients from the P2P, lender microfinance, banking, insurance, funds management, third-party payment, air travel, e-commerce, O2O, gaming, social media, live video streaming etc., industries intelligent total risk control solutions that are highly efficient.
As a Leader in Intelligent Risk Management, Tongdun wishes to constantly improve its services through continuous product and technology innovation, and applies Artificial Intelligence deeply into the area of internet risk management and antifraud. After rapid growth in the last few years, Tongdun has become the largest and most respected service provider in the industry, with more than 10000 corporations whom has chosen Tongdun as its suppler of choice. In addition to the trust of clients, Tongdun is also favored by top capital institutions both at home and abroad with the brand of the most commercially valuable service provider within the intelligent risk management industry in China. Up to now, Tongdun has received five rounds of financing, with the total amount of nearly 200 million dollars, and was listed in the “Top100 Global Science & Technology Innovators 2015” by the Red Herring Magazine and “Best Cloud-based Application in China 2017” by the Asian Banker, “Best Risk Management Partner” of China’s Leaders in Fintech 2017 by the Asia Money. Besides, Tongdun also received many other awards.
In December, 2017, Tongdun issued the service philosophy of AaaS (Analysis as a Service). It is an innovative approach based on the traditional risk control service. AaaS is different from the traditional patterns like IaaS (Infrastructure as a Service), PaaS (Platform as a Service) and SaaS (Software as a Service), which solely provide a platform, a tool or data service. AaaS can provide analytical service based on intelligent algorithm models in multiple segmented financial scenarios (such as marketing, risk control, investment and operation) as per business demands of different financial institutions, thus empowering financial institutions with capabilities and boosting core competitiveness of financial institutions.
Tongdun Technology was awarded a “High and New Technology Enterprise” certificate on November 13, 2017. The awarding of this status reflects the State’s recognition of and support for the company’s innovation ability and development potential.
In early 2018, Tongdun Technology and Zhejiang University joined hands to set up an artificial intelligence laboratory for the purpose of exploring frontier technologies and commercial applications in artificial intelligence.
Tongdun International, the Singapore arm of Tongdun Technology, was incorporated in January 2018 as a foray into the Southeast Asia market. At the same time, Tongdun has invested in a blockchain research institute in Canada to delve into Live Apps that use blockchain technology.
Today, with headquarters in Hangzhou, Tongdun Technology has branches in Singapore, Beijing, Shanghai, Shenzhen, Guangzhou, Chengdu, Xi’an, Chongqing and many other cities. More than 70% of Tongdun’s team members are veteran experts in big data, technology, risk management, anti-fraud, artificial intelligence and other related area. Fueled by a fundamental belief that having access to financial services creates opportunity, PayPal (NASDAQ: PYPL) is committed to democratizing financial services and empowering people and businesses to join and thrive in the global economy. Our open digital payments platform gives PayPal’s 267 million active account holders the confidence to connect and transact in new and powerful ways, whether they are online, on a mobile device, in an app, or in person. Through a combination of technological innovation and strategic partnerships, PayPal creates better ways to manage and move money and offers choice and flexibility when sending payments, paying or getting paid. Available in more than 200 markets around the world, the PayPal platform, including Braintree, Venmo and Xoom, enables consumers and merchants to receive money in more than 100 currencies, withdraw funds in 56 currencies and hold balances in their PayPal accounts in 25 currencies.

CardUp is a credit card enablement platform, which enables the payment or collection of big expenses using credit card, in places where cards are not accepted today. Examples of payments include rent, tax, invoices, payroll and more, which are still paid by cash, cheque or bank transfer.
With CardUp, individuals and businesses can now shift these big payments to their existing credit cards. This provides an unparalleled opportunity to earn credit card rewards, access interest-free credit and digitise payments – making big payments rewarding.
CardUp manages hundreds of millions in payment volume in Singapore today.
